  • Patent number: 11398823
    Abstract: A sensor switch including a first sensor electrode and a second sensor electrode at least partially surrounding the first sensor electrode. An evaluation and control circuit of the sensor switch is configured to generate a switch output signal if a first sensor electrode attenuation signal indicates a high signal attenuation, a second sensor electrode attenuation signal indicates a low signal attenuation, and a cross-coupling signal from the first to the second electrode indicates a low cross-coupling.

  • Patent number: 11307056
    Abstract: A capacitive sensor including a sensor electrode connected to a signal generation circuit and a signal evaluation circuit. The signal generation circuit contains a signal generator that is a noise generator or a pseudo-noise generator, the signal evaluation circuit includes a synchronous rectifier. The synchronous rectifier is connected for synchronization to the signal generator.

  • Patent number: 9250110
    Abstract: Methods of volume measurement of a liquid are described. During extraction or feed of the liquid, at least two time points of the altered volume of the liquid is measured. Respective hydrostatic pressures are measured at these time points. The pressure difference is determined and the current volume of the liquid present in the container is determined.

  • Patent number: 6328235
    Abstract: The invention relates to a process and an apparatus for decomposing articles, especially contaminated articles, by means of a decomposition device. To make it possible to the use an easily manipulated decomposition device while avoiding bulky devices, and at the same time to enable in-situ decomposition, in the tightest possible space, in a way that suits packing needs, it is proposed that the decomposition device execute an oscillating motion such that as a function of the progress and/or duration of the decomposition of the article, a varying resultant of the direction of decomposition force introduced by the decomposition device is established.

  • Patent number: 4439403
    Abstract: There is described an apparatus for handling and conditioning biologically injurious waste, especially radioactive waste which consists of a working space or chamber having containers for receiving and dosing the waste, conveying and control devices for the waste and the additions and a filling station for filling the final storage container. It is characterized by the working space having a slanting bottom running into a sump, the containers for receiving and dosing the waste being surrounded by a variable shielding, the cover of the final storage container provided with a stirrer convertable to the stirrer driving mechanism taking place by means of a slidable lift which supports the driving mechanism, a waste supply line, a waste air line, a positioning device and stopping pins, and controlling the sequence of operations by a freely programmable control.
